ISNUMERIC (Transact-SQL)

Bir ifade geçerli bir sayısal tür olup olmadığını belirler.

Topic link iconTransact-SQL sözdizimi kuralları

ISNUMERIC ( expression )

Bağımsız değişkenler

  • expression
    ifade değerlendirilecek.

Dönüş Türleri

int

Remarks

Geçerli bir sayısal veri türü için giriş ifade değerlendirir ISNUMERIC 1 döndürür; aksi halde 0 değerini döndürür.Geçerli bir sayısal veri türleri şunlardır:

int

numeric

bigint

money

smallint

smallmoney

tinyint

float

decimal

real

Not

ISNUMERIC (-), sayılar gibi olmayan artı (+), bazı karakterler için 1 verir ve dolar işareti ($) gibi geçerli para birimi simgelerini.Para birimi simgelerini tam listesi için bkz: Parasal veri kullanma.

Örnekler

Aşağıdaki örnek kullanır. ISNUMERIC sayısal değerleri olan posta kodlarını dönmek için .

USE AdventureWorks;
GO
SELECT City, PostalCode
FROM Person.Address 
WHERE ISNUMERIC(PostalCode)<> 1;
GO